Description Thorsten Staerk 2009-05-11 04:27:50 UTC
When I use subpages, this is mostly because I have a deep structure. For example, I have 
Tutorials > Programming Tutorials > C Programming Tutorial > How to simulate a keypress. 
In my opinion, the page title should not appear "fully qualified". It is too long and confuses the reader. You already get the complete path twice: Once in the URL bar of your browser and once as the subpage-navigation-links.

Please only show the page title without the path-prefix if subpages are activated.
Comment 1 Happy-melon 2009-05-17 18:58:18 UTC
Page titles are supposed to be copy-and-paste-able functional wikilinks. If the page [[Foo/bar/baz]] displayed as "Baz", then copying it would obviously *not* make a functional link to the page; it would of course link to [[Baz]] instead.  Not A Nice Thought.
Comment 2 Chad H. 2009-07-15 19:33:06 UTC
Comment #1 has it right, marking WONTFIX.

Page titles are supposed to be fully qualified. Displaytitle also works if you want to change them.
